Ocean Zones

•The chart above is a picture of the different layers of the ocean. Many different
animals lived in these zones. The next few slides will describe the different zones
and the animals that live there.
The Epipelagic Zone- Algae
• The Epipelagic Zone is where most of the plants and animals of the ocean live
• It is nicknamed the “Sunlight Zone” because it is where most visible light exists
• Algae is a plant that is found in the Epipelagic Zone
• It provides oxygen for other marine animals
• Algae grows by the process of photosynthesis
• Photosynthesis­ a process used by plants and other organisms to covert light
energy, normally from the sun, into chemical energy that can be later released to
fuel the organisms’ activities

Ocean Algae
Mesopelagic Zone- Comb Jellies
• In the Mesopelagic Zone, fish use bioluminescence to see in the dark waters
• Bioluminescence­ is the production of light by a living organism
• One animal that lives in the Mesopelagic Zone is the Comb Jelly
• It is not related to the jellyfish at all
• The Comb Jellies have lived in the ocean for about 5 million years
• It has long trailing tentacles and will almost eat anything it runs into

Comb Jelly

Abyssal Zone- Giant Squid
• Sunlight doesn’t reach the Abyssal Zone
• The animals in this zone usually are invertebrates
• Invertebrates- animals without a backbone
• The Giant Squid lives in this layer of the ocean
• It moves by jet propulsion which consists of collecting the ocean water and
shooting it out

Giant Squid
Hadal Zone- Sea Cucumber & Sea Spider
• Nicknamed the Trench Zone because the deepest trenches are in this zone
• It is dark and cold
• Animals in this zone have adapted to the darkness by reducing their use of
eyesight
• The Sea Cucumber eats floating food like algae
• They break down their food into tiny pieces which then becomes food for bacteria
• The Sea Spider is related to horseshoe crabs, scorpions, and mites
• They eat jelly fish and other soft body animals by ripping them to bits
